It's easy to see where the confusion comes from. trust media to blur the edges

It is understood the proposals also include an increase in the waiting period for people to become citizens from three years to four years.

The requirement was last year raised from two to three years in an attempt to contain the home-grown terror threat. At that time, then citizenship minister John Cobb said the longer migrants spent in Australian society before gaining citizenship, the less vulnerable they were to "falling in with extreme groups".
